Output e6a50ced14bbcb5340ac3bb24ea729e1981d8eb2ca9424eb00955ca329bf77f7:0

value
33608951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46269efb8697f6fd3e0ce3136b1a0983f4ae4746 OP_EQUAL
address
385wVQc1tMeA8NQ6xE9pJmLN2kSCcQZrj2
transaction
e6a50ced14bbcb5340ac3bb24ea729e1981d8eb2ca9424eb00955ca329bf77f7
spent
true